The Basics of Metal Finishing - Frequently, the polishing of metal is desirable for aesthetic reasons and clean-room applications. It really is among the most common treatments simply because of its utility in intensifying the original beauty of the product, for example, motor bike parts, car parts or cookware. Furthermore, a large number of clean-rooms require a sleek finish so as to lower the penetrability of the components that could cause dust to gather and contaminate. A great illustration of this application would be in a vacuum chamber.

There are certainly lots of approaches to polish metals, and we can have a look at examples of the steps required. Various metals can be polished manually by hand, with spec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A particular polishing compound or paste is frequently used, which could contain lim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is amongst the time intensive. On the flip side, merchandise produced with non-ferrous metal are definitely more amenable to finishing, as they require the least amount of procedures.

Finishing buffs covered with paste will be substantially affected by specific force on the surface of the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ure may be amplified within certain constraints, although overreaching the ideal amount of force not only decreases the quality of the process, but additionally can worsen effectiveness, causes wear to the component, and there's furthermore an obvious heating up of the work-pieces, on account of friction. When working thinner metal, it is increased heat (and the ensuing flexibility of the metal) that can cause materials to buckle, twist or distort. In general, it will require a practiced polisher to consider each one of these elements to both avert harm to the part and to perform the task correctly. To be able to substantially improve the standard of the completed finish, the polishing procedure must be accomplished with much less vigour and not so much force so that you can in due course de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scores or marks which result from the polishing procedure, thus ar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
